Tree Rat-a-touille

Tree Rat-a-touille in the Oven

Serves: 4
Preparation Time: 10 mins
Cooking Time: 30 mins (oven)

Ingredients
2 red onions, quartered
2 red or yellow peppers, deseeded and cut into chunks
1 aubergine, chopped
3 courgettes cut into thick slices
3 tblsp. olive oil
2 cloves garlic, crushed
2 tblsp. chopped oregano or thyme
400g tin chopped tomatoes

Method
1. Put all the vegetables except the tomatoes in a large roasting tin, pour over the oil and stir through the garlic and herbs.

2. Season with sea salt and black pepper.

3. Roast at Gas 6, 200 C for 30 minutes.

4. Stir in the tomatoes and roast for ten more minutes until hot.

Serve with barbequed Squirrel.
